Ingredients for Mandarin Fish:

  • Fish boneless 250 gm
  • Salt 1 tsp
  • White pepper 1 tsp
  • Egg 1
  • Flour 2 tbsp
  • Corn flour 2 tbsp
  • Water 1/4 cup
  • Stock 1 cup
  • Oil 1/4 cup
  • Garlic crushed 1 tbsp
  • Ketchup 1/2 cup
  • Hp sauce 1 tbsp
  • Wooster sauce 1 tbsp
  • Chili sauce 1 tbsp
  • Sugar 1 tbsp

Ingredients for Chengdu Chicken:

  • Chicken boneless 1/2 kg
  • Salt 1 tsp
  • White pepper 1/2 tsp
  • Corn flour 2 tsp
  • egg 1/2 beaten
  • Whole red button chillies 10
  • Kashmiri red chillies 2
  • Oil 1/4 cup
  • Garlic crushed 1 tsp
  • Vinegar 2 tsp
  • Wooster sauce 1 tbsp
  • Hp sauce 1 tbsp
  • Ketchup 1/4 cup
  • Chili garlic sauce 1 tbsp

Ingredients for Mixed Fried Rice:

  • Rice 1/2 kg
  • Cabbage 1 cup
  • Carrot 1 cup
  • Spring onion 1 cup
  • Chicken boiled 1 cup
  • Oil 1/2 cup
  • Eggs 2
  • Salt 1 tsp
  • White sauce 1/2 tsp
  • Soya sauce 2 tbsp
  • Crushed garlic 1 tbsp

Ingredients for 8 Treasure Soup:

  • Chicken stock 8 cups
  • Carrot 2 tbsp
  • Cabbage 2 tbsp
  • Mushrooms 4
  • Peas boiled 1/4 cup
  • Spring onion 2 tbsp
  • Bean curd 1 piece
  • Prawns 6
  • Chicken breast 1
  • Salt 1-1/2 tsp
  • White pepper 1 tsp
  • Corn flour 5 tbsp
  • Egg 1
  • Coriander leaves 2 tbsp

Ingredients for Apple Coconut Cookie Smoothie:

  • 1 apple
  • 1 cup milk
  • 2 cookies
  • 1/2 tsp vanilla essence
  • 1 packet badami kulfa balls
  • 2 tbsp desiccated coconut
  • 1 cup crushed ice
  • 2 tbsp sugar
